Transaction 851081ed3f3f11ec90d556489575041cebdd231ffbecf878adecb8d31f31eed4
1 Input
2 Outputs
- 851081ed3f3f11ec90d556489575041cebdd231ffbecf878adecb8d31f31eed4:0
- 851081ed3f3f11ec90d556489575041cebdd231ffbecf878adecb8d31f31eed4:1
value 314088
address 3KUGm5WTmQJBLDXVAUwmaq4zDNkFdkMgxb
value 26252
address 1NR1j2dSZC9ERBtVC3CW6QCxsAhAZTmnHf